Buried Treasures
A brilliant record -- how most of these beguiling tracks were never released at the time is a mystery! I guess the right people just didn't take her work seriously—maybe it was just too subtle. Throughout, Vashti comes across as a sort of English Françoise Hardy. Some of the songs -- in particular the superb I'd Like to Walk Around in Your Mind and Winter Is Blue—have inventive, sensitive arrangements. One listen to them and you'll be hooked. Most of the tracks, however, are home demos that feature Vashti solo on guitar, charmingly introducing the title of each track, so that you really feel you're in the room. Quite different -- more straightforwardly melodic, more direct -- than her later folky output [which is also great in a different way], this is essential for anyone with affection for great 60s pop music.

A very nice selection of early songs and demos
A very nice selection of early songs and demos, including private tape transfers. The sound quality of some is not top standard - thus no top score - but I find this an interesting addition to my collection of sixties pop music.
